Taxon: Huperzia x buttersii (Abbe) Kartesz & Gandhi
Family: Lycopodiaceae
Determiner: Robert Preston (2004-02-00)
ID Remarks: = H. lucidula x H. selago
Collector: Gerdes, Lynden B.   4489   
Date: 2001-09-06
Locality: United States, Minnesota, Lake, Tettegoche State Park, Silver Bay, MN. Northwest-facing cliff approximately 0.44 mile east of Nipisquit Lake. T56N R07W S09NENW
47.350603  -91.229562 +-969m.
Habitat: Upper talus near the base of a northwest-facing cliff with Thuja occidentalis, Betula papyrifera, Sorbus decora, etc.
Description: Stems long, swooping & bending; mod. long & wooly leaves; stems forking at various locations; green.
